Web1 day ago · Hyderabad: Hyderabad city police commissioner C.V. Anand said Wednesday that of a daily average of 100 FIRs being filed in his jurisdiction, 50 percent pertain to cybercrime. Specifically, half of these are pure cybercrime — such as harassment using loan apps, phishing, and hacking cases — while the rest have some sort of digital link.
